INTRODUCTION This book is a supplementary book to the Core Cold War Rule set, it is designed to add Independent Force lists and their equipment. The lists are to add further character to the existing lists, and cover alternative forces in the European and Scandinavian Theatre. Many of the lists lack heavy armour and are made up of significant amounts of Medium Armoured Vehicles and this adds further depth and flavour to fighting with these forces.
